Organise your Pictures
If you want to create your photo book online efficiently, you will need to first collect all of your images and put them in a logical order. Don’t forget to include the photos on your social media accounts and cloud storage services.
Pick out the pictures you love and put them all in one folder on your computer and name it “Photo Book Pictures” or any other way you want so you can find them easily. It will be much easier and faster to create your picture book if you keep things organised.
You can also ask loved ones to send in pictures. With more memories to choose from, the picture book will have greater depth and significance.

Create a Flowing Layout
The arrangement of your picture book determines how your audience will see it. This is a crucial part of making a presentation that people want to see.
If you want people to pay closer attention to certain pictures, use focus points to draw their attention to them. It could be the most treasured photograph ever taken, or the most famous family reunion photo you have ever photographed. One way to draw attention to a photo is by displaying it with a full-bleed spread. Alternatively, you can feature a big picture prominently with smaller ones surrounding it.
Experimenting with different layouts is another technique for establishing a focal point or points of focus. Put simply, resist the urge to carelessly attach a single picture to every page and proceed. This may be sufficient for simpler picture books, but if you’re planning an elaborate photo book of a business event or a fantastic trip, you’ll want to spice things up a little.
Another suitable approach is to use the same page layout several times throughout the book. For example, you can use the previously described big-picture-next-to-smaller-ones configuration on one page and then apply it at other times throughout your photo book.

Order Your Photo Book
Thoroughly examine every aspect before completing your picture book. Check for any errors, layout problems, or typing errors. Use the preview feature that many platforms provide to see how your purchase will turn out before you commit to ordering it.
If you’re happy with the outcome, you can proceed to order your photo book. This is also the time to select the print run, quantity, and cover type (hardcover, softcover, etc.). Carefully review these options before finalising your purchase.
